Senior Geoenvironmental Consultant
Salary: £40,000 - £50,000
Location: Birmingham

A well-established environmental and geotechnical consultancy is looking to appoint a Senior Geoenvironmental Consultant to join their Birmingham team. The role will suit an experienced geoenvironmental professional looking to take on greater responsibility across a varied project portfolio, with a good balance of site work, technical reporting and project management.

You will work across a range of contaminated land, ground investigation and remediation projects, supporting projects from initial investigation through to assessment, reporting and remediation.

The Role:

  • Managing and supervising ground investigations and contaminated land assessments
  • Producing Phase 1 Preliminary Risk Assessments and Phase 2 Site Investigation reports
  • Reviewing historical, geological and environmental data
  • Developing conceptual site models and undertaking contamination risk assessments
  • Soil, groundwater and gas monitoring and sampling
  • Managing subcontractors and site investigation contractors
  • Interpreting laboratory data and assessing potential pollutant linkages
  • Producing remediation strategies and validation reports
  • Supporting remediation projects and overseeing validation works
  • Preparing technical reports and presenting findings to clients
  • Managing projects, budgets and programmes
  • Liaising with clients, regulators, contractors and other consultants
  • Supporting and mentoring junior members of the team

Requirements:

  • Degree in Geology, Environmental Science, Environmental Geology or a related discipline
  • Strong experience within geoenvironmental consultancy
  • Experience delivering contaminated land and ground investigation projects
  • Good understanding of UK contaminated land legislation and guidance
  • Experience with Phase 1 and Phase 2 investigations
  • Strong technical report writing skills
  • Commercial awareness and experience managing projects
  • Full UK driving licence
